ORDINANCE NO. 150286
Approving an amendment to a
previously approved Chapter 80 preliminary development plan for a 3.36 acre
property at N.W. Harlem Road and N. Main Street in Districts M1-5 to allow for
the construction of a single story warehouse. (7300-P-6)
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E
COUNCIL OF KANSAS CITY:
Section A. That an
amendment to a previously approved Chapter 80 preliminary development plan in
District M1-5 (Manufacturing 1 (dash 5)) on a 3.36 acre tract of land generally
located at the northwest corner of N.W. Harlem Road and N. Main Street, and
more specifically described as follows:
114 NW Harlem Road,
Harlem Lots 15 and 16, Block 2.
Harlem Lots 1-8,
Block 2, Lots 9-14 and west 40 feet Lots 15 and 16, Block 3 and vacated N.
Baltimore Avenue.
16 NW Harlem
Road/east 40 feet of west 80 feet Lots 15 and 16, Block 3, Harlem
12 NW Harlem
Road/vacated lot Harlem east 50 feet of Lots 15 and 16, Block 3.
is hereby approved, subject to
the following conditions:
1.
That the developer provide landscaping in compliance with Section 88-425
“Landscaping and Screening.”
2.
That the developer meet the requirement of Chapter 52 for parking and
drive aisles.
3.
That the developer remove fencing from the north/south alley next west
of vacated N. Baltimore Avenue or vacate the alley and provide an easement to
landlocked property owner.
4.
That the developer submit a Chapter 80 Final Plan for approval.
5.
That the developer submit a storm drainage analysis from a
Missouri-licensed civil engineer to the Land Development Division, in
accordance with adopted standards, including a BMP level of service analysis
prior to approval and issuance of any building permits, and that the developer
secure permits to construct any improvements as required by the Land
Development Division prior to issuance of any certificate of occupancy.
6.
That the owner/developer submit plans for grading, siltation, and
erosion control to Land Development Division for review and acceptance, and
secure a site disturbance permit for any proposed disturbance area equal to one
acre or more prior to beginning any construction activities.
7.
That the developer submit an analysis to verify adequate capacity of the
existing sewer system as required by the Land Development Division prior to
issuance of a building permit to connect a private system to the public sewer
main and depending on adequacy of the receiving system, make other improvements
as may be required.
8.
That the developer grant a BMP Easement to the City as required by the
Land Development Division, prior to recording the plat or issuance of any
building permits.
9.
That the proposed development is located in an area where the Charles B.
Wheeler Downtown Airport height zoning restrictions apply. No structure in this
area should be constructed which exceeds these restrictions.
10.
That the proposed project location is in proximity to the Charles B.
Wheeler Downtown Airport Part 77 Horizontal Surface with an approximate elevation
of 908 feet.
11.
That this proposed development needs to review and comply with the
City’s Airport height zone Ordinance No. 040342 and
associated maps.
A copy of said development plan
is on file in the office of the City Clerk with this ordinance and is made a
part hereof.
Section B. That the Council finds and
declares that before taking any action on the proposed amendment hereinabove,
all public notices and hearings required by the Zoning Ordinance have been
given and had.
